clearscreen. set radarOffset to 31. // The value of alt:radar when landed (on gear) lock trueRadar to alt:radar - radarOffset. // Offset radar to get distance from gear to ground lock g to constant:g * body:mass / body:radius^2. // Gravity (m/s^2) lock maxDecel to (ship:availablethrust / ship:mass) - g. // Maximum deceleration possible (m/s^2) lock stopDist to ship:verticalspeed^2 / (2 * maxDecel). // The distance the burn will require lock idealThrottle to stopDist / trueRadar. // Throttle required for perfect hoverslam lock impactTime to trueRadar / abs(ship:verticalspeed). // Time until impact, used for landing gear WAIT UNTIL ship:verticalspeed < -1. print "Preparing for hoverslam...". rcs on. brakes on. lock steering to srfretrograde. when impactTime < 3 then {gear on.} WAIT UNTIL trueRadar < stopDist. print "Performing hoverslam". lock throttle to idealThrottle. WAIT UNTIL ship:verticalspeed > -0.01. print "Hoverslam completed". set ship:control:pilotmainthrottle to 0. rcs off.
